This BAC calculator uses the Widmark formula, the most widely accepted method for estimating blood alcohol concentration. It gives you a ballpark number for planning purposes. It is not a breathalyzer, a medical test, or legal proof of sobriety.

How the Blood Alcohol Calculator Works

The calculator takes a few inputs: the number of standard drinks you consumed, your body weight, your gender, and how much time has passed since you started drinking. It then applies the Widmark equation to estimate your BAC.

Here is the simplified version of that formula:

BAC = (Alcohol consumed in grams / (Body weight in grams × r)) − (0.015 × hours since first drink)

The variable r is a gender-based constant. It accounts for differences in body water distribution. For males, r is typically 0.68. For females, it is typically 0.55.

The 0.015 subtracted per hour reflects average alcohol metabolism. Most people eliminate roughly one standard drink per hour, though this varies.

Calculate Your Blood Alcohol Concentration

Number of standard drinks you consume

The calculator asks how many standard drinks you have had. This is the single biggest factor in your estimated BAC. More drinks means more grams of alcohol entering your bloodstream.

Be honest and precise here. A "drink" at a bar or party is often larger than a standard drink. A strong craft IPA in a pint glass can equal nearly two standard drinks. A generous wine pour can be 1.5 or more.

If you are unsure, round up. Underestimating drink count is the most common reason BAC estimates come in too low.

Weight, gender, and other factors that approximate BAC

Body weight matters because alcohol distributes through body water. A heavier person has more volume for the alcohol to dilute into, resulting in a lower BAC from the same number of drinks.

Gender affects the calculation because of body composition differences. Women generally have a higher percentage of body fat and a lower percentage of body water than men of the same weight. This means alcohol concentrates more in a smaller water volume, producing a higher BAC.

Other factors the calculator cannot fully capture include:

  • Amount of food in your stomach. Eating before or while drinking slows alcohol absorption.
  • Metabolism rate. Individual liver enzyme activity varies. The calculator uses an average rate of 0.015 per hour.
  • Age and overall health. Older adults and people with certain health issues may process alcohol more slowly.
  • Medications. Some drugs slow metabolism or amplify alcohol's effects.

Because of these numerous factors, every BAC calculator produces an estimate, not a measurement.

What Is Blood Alcohol Content?

Blood alcohol content is the measure of alcohol present in your bloodstream. Law enforcement, medical professionals, and researchers all use BAC as the standard metric for intoxication.

Blood alcohol concentration as a percentage

BAC is expressed as a percentage of alcohol in your blood. Specifically, it represents grams of alcohol per 100 ml of blood. A BAC of 0.08 means 0.08 grams of alcohol per 100 ml of blood.

Here are some reference points:

  • 0.00% means no measurable alcohol in your blood.
  • 0.02% is a light, relaxed feeling for most people.
  • 0.08% is the legal limit for drivers age 21 and over in all 50 U.S. states.
  • 0.15% and above indicates severe impairment.
  • 0.30%+ carries risk of loss of consciousness or worse.

How alcohol concentration builds in your blood

When you consume alcohol, it passes through your stomach and small intestine into your bloodstream. Peak BAC typically occurs 30 to 70 minutes after your last drink, depending on stomach contents and drink speed.

Your liver then metabolizes the alcohol at a roughly constant rate, about 0.015 per hour for most people. This means BAC drops in a straight line over time rather than a curve.

If you drink faster than your liver can process, your BAC climbs. That is why spacing drinks and eating food both help keep your blood alcohol concentration lower.

What Is a Standard Drink of Beer, Wine, and Liquor?

A standard drink contains approximately 14 grams of pure alcohol. This is the baseline the calculator uses. The container size changes depending on the beverage because each type has a different alcohol by volume (ABV).

Alcohol by volume and how to measure each drink

BeverageTypical ABVStandard Drink Size
Beer~5%12 fl oz
Wine~12%5 fl oz
Distilled spirits (liquor)~40%1.5 fl oz

These are guidelines, not absolutes. A 9% double IPA in a 16 oz pint is roughly 2.4 standard drinks. A 6 oz pour of 14% red wine is about 1.4 standard drinks.

To measure more accurately:

  1. Check the ABV on the label.
  2. Note the actual volume of your pour or can.
  3. Multiply ABV × volume (in ounces) × 0.6. Divide by 0.6 oz (the alcohol in one standard drink) to get your standard drink count.

Getting this right makes the BAC calculator far more useful.

BAC Effect and Impairment at Each Level

Alcohol affects your brain in a predictable progression. Here is what research generally associates with each BAC level:

  • 0.01 to 0.03: Subtle relaxation. Minimal measurable impairment.
  • 0.04 to 0.06: Lowered inhibitions, mild euphoria, and slightly reduced motor control.
  • 0.07 to 0.09: Impaired balance, speech, reaction time, and judgment. At 0.08, it is illegal to drive in every U.S. state.
  • 0.10 to 0.12: Clear deterioration of motor control and judgment. Slurred speech is common.
  • 0.13 to 0.19: Major impairment to coordination and perception. Risk of blackout increases.
  • 0.20 to 0.29: Disorientation, nausea, and inability to stand or walk without help. Memory blackout is likely.
  • 0.30 and above: Risk of loss of consciousness, respiratory depression, and death.

Individual tolerance does not change BAC or its physiological effects. A "high tolerance" means your brain has adapted to functioning under impairment. It does not mean your BAC is lower or that you are safe to drive or operate machinery.

How alcohol and other drugs increase impairment

Mixing alcohol and other drugs, whether prescription, over the counter, or recreational, can multiply impairment beyond what BAC alone would predict. Common interactions include:

  • Sedatives and benzodiazepines: Dramatically increase drowsiness and respiratory depression.
  • Opioids: Combined depressant effects raise overdose risk.
  • Antihistamines: Heighten drowsiness and slow reaction time.
  • Stimulants: Can mask the feeling of intoxication without lowering BAC, leading people to drink more.

This calculator does not account for drug interactions. If you have taken any medication or substance alongside alcohol, your actual impairment may be significantly worse than the BAC estimate suggests.

Can You Drink and Drive? Legal BAC Limits

In the United States, it is illegal to drive with a BAC of 0.08 or higher if you are 21 or older. But lower thresholds apply in many situations:

  • Under the legal drinking age of 21: Most states enforce a zero-tolerance policy, typically 0.00 to 0.02.
  • Commercial drivers: The federal limit is 0.04.
  • Utah: The legal limit is 0.05 for all drivers.

Many countries also set limits at 0.05 or lower. Check local laws before assuming 0.08 is universal.

Important: even a BAC below the legal limit can impair your ability to drive or operate machinery. Impairment begins well before 0.08. A BAC of 0.05 already reduces coordination and increases crash risk.

If the calculator shows any measurable BAC, the safest choice is not to drive.

Why This BAC Estimate Is Approximate

No online calculator can replace a breathalyzer or blood test. This tool uses population averages and a simplified formula. Your actual BAC can vary because of many factors:

  • Individual metabolism differs. The 0.015 per hour rate is an average, not your personal rate.
  • Stomach contents, hydration, fatigue, and body composition all shift real results.
  • Drink strength can be hard to estimate, especially with mixed drinks and craft beverages.
  • The calculator assumes you reported drink count and timing accurately.

Blood Alcohol Content Calculator FAQs

How do I calculate BAC after one drink?

For a rough estimate after one standard drink, plug these numbers into the Widmark formula. A 160 lb male drinking one standard drink (14 grams of pure alcohol) would calculate:

BAC = 14 / (72,575 × 0.68) = approximately 0.028

After one hour of metabolism (subtract 0.015), the estimated BAC drops to about 0.013. After two hours, it is near zero.

A lighter person or a female would see a higher number from the same drink. The easiest approach is to enter your details in the calculator above rather than doing the math by hand.

How long after you consume alcohol does BAC drop?

Your BAC begins to drop as soon as your liver starts metabolizing alcohol, which happens continuously. The average person's BAC decreases by about 0.015 per hour.

That means if your BAC peaks at 0.08, it takes roughly five to six hours to return to 0.00. Drinking water, eating, or drinking coffee does not speed up this process. Only time reduces BAC.

Peak BAC typically occurs 30 to 70 minutes after your last drink. So your BAC may still be rising even after you stop drinking.
